About the Opportunity
As a Senior Project Accountant, you will play a crucial role in managing financial aspects of asset development, ensuring accuracy, compliance, and efficiency. You’ll work in a dynamic, forward-thinking environment where collaboration and sustainability are at the heart of every decision.
Your key deliverables will include:
- Maintain accurate financial records for asset development projects, ensuring correct classification of capital and operational expenditure. Prepare financial reports for internal and external stakeholders, including banks and investors.
- Assist in developing Capex budgets, track project costs, and provide variance analysis to support strategic decision-making.
- Oversee lease accounting, loan balances, and interest calculations. Ensure compliance with accounting standards and eliminate related-party transactions in consolidated reporting.
- Support the annual audit processes and manage tax compliance for project-related matters, including GST, corporate tax, and R&D incentives.
- Verify invoices, liaise with banks for facility drawdowns, and support project financing and refinancing activities.
- Assist in optimising financial processes and support the implementation of a new accounting system.
Ideal Profile
- CPA/CA qualification or equivalent coupled with 8+ years industry experience
- 3-5 years in project accounting, preferably within infrastructure, asset development, or renewable energy.
- Strong understanding of Capex/Opex, revenue recognition, financial reporting, and lease accounting. Experience with R&D tax incentives is a plus.
- Strong knowledge of accounting standards, financial controls, and governance.
- Proficiency in Xero and experience in ERP implementations or financial system enhancements.
- A proactive mindset with the ability to work autonomously and manage competing priorities.
